Your Fleet as a Mobile Marketing Asset: The Brand Image Advantage

Company vehicles are moving billboards that work every hour they are on the road. Across Brisbane North, Caboolture, Samford, Dayboro, and the wider Moreton Bay region, a single van can rack up thousands of daily views at traffic lights, job sites, and school runs. Fleet detailing turns that everyday visibility into steady, positive brand exposure.

First impressions stick. A gleaming car or truck signals discipline, care, and quality. Cloudy paint, streaked glass, and dirty wheels can plant doubt about workmanship and safety before your team says hello. Fleet detailing keeps signage high-contrast and paint crisp, so your brand carries authority in every suburb and on every route.

Consistency matters just as much as the first glance. When every vehicle looks as tidy as the next, buyers read it as reliability:

  • For trade services, tidy utes and vans suggest strong process on site.
  • For corporate fleets, immaculate sedans and SUVs help sales teams arrive with quiet confidence.
  • For delivery vehicles, a clean exterior hints at care taken with orders inside.

This is how fleet detailing builds trust day after day.

Clean vehicles also attract talent. People want to work for firms that look after their gear. Regular fleet cleaning services show care for staff and assets, and that culture is visible from the kerb. It is powerful in a crowded Brisbane market where differentiation is hard to claim.

Protecting Your Investment: How Detailing Extends Vehicle Lifespan

Your fleet is a major investment, and Queensland conditions are tough on paint, trim, and interiors. Intense UV rays fade clear coats, high humidity and coastal air add salt, and road grime plus industrial fallout build up fast. Fleet detailing acts as preventative care that shields surfaces and slows wear.

On the outside:

  • Professional waxing, polymer sealants, and ceramic coatings create sacrificial layers that take the hit from UV, bird drops, tar, and fallout—so your paint does not.
  • Regular contact washing with pH-neutral shampoos clears away corrosive dirt before it bites, helping gloss last longer and reducing clear coat failure.
  • Decontamination steps (iron removal and clay) keep surfaces smooth, which helps coatings bond and paint stay cleaner longer.

Underbody and hard-to-reach zones need attention too, especially for 4x4s and work utes:

  • Removing mud, salt, and clay reduces the risk of rust forming in seams and rails.
  • A clean engine bay helps spot leaks early, makes servicing easier, and keeps components cooler and safer to handle.
  • Headlight restoration brings back clarity, improving night visibility and keeping vehicles safe on long runs.

Inside the cabin, daily use can grind in stains and odours:

  • Steam cleaning, fabric extraction, and leather conditioning prevent permanent damage and help seats, carpets, and trims hold their value.
  • Ozone Treatment is ideal for tough smells in high-use vehicles, removing stubborn smoke, food, or damp odours at the source.
  • This is where commercial vehicle detailing stands apart from a basic wash.

For vehicles in harsh conditions, a fleet detailing cycle every four to six weeks is a strong baseline. That timing keeps contaminants from settling, reduces major paint correction later, and cuts surprise interior repairs. The Financial Case: Measurable Cost Savings and ROI

Treat fleet detailing as investment protection, not a discretionary spend. Well-kept vehicles sell faster and for more. Buyers and dealers pay a premium for clean paint, clear headlights, tidy interiors, and solid records. The difference between a maintained and a neglected vehicle can be thousands of dollars at trade-in.

Preventative care also keeps repair bills down. Removing salt and fallout reduces corrosion. Protecting paint slows clear coat failure. Interior care stops stains becoming replacement jobs. Small problems get spotted earlier when vehicles are clean, which means cheaper fixes and less downtime.

Mobile fleet detailing adds another layer of savings. When the service comes to your depot or office, staff do not lose hours driving cars to a workshop, waiting, and returning. That means lower labour costs, less fuel, and more billable time. Flexible scheduling after hours or on weekends keeps vehicles earning while still getting the attention they need.
